P0106 - CHRYSLER - Manifold Absolute Pressure Sensor Performance

Symptoms

- Engine Light ON (or Service Engine Soon Warning Light) - Engine rough idle - Engine hesitation

Possible Causes

- Manifold Absolute Pressure harness is open or shorted - Manifold Absolute Pressure sensor poor electrical circuit connector - Faulty Manifold Absolute Pressure sensor - Faulty Powertrain Control Module (PCM)

When Detected

An excessively low or high voltage from the sensor is sent to ECM

Description

The Manifold Absolute Pressure (MAP) sensor provides instantaneous manifold pressure information to the engine's Powertrain Control Module (PCM). The data is used to calculate air density and determine the engine's air mass flow rate, which in turn determines the required fuel metering for optimum combustion. A fuel-injected engine may alternately use a Mass Air Flow (MAF) sensor to detect the intake airflow. A typical configuration employs one or the other, but seldom both.
